Weather<br />

Guided sightseeing<br />

Access to national parks &<br />

concessions<br />

Victoria Falls<br />

J F M A M J J A S O N D<br />

A 31 30 31 30 28 26 26 29 33 34 33 31<br />

B 20 19 18 16 11 8 7 10 15 19 20 20<br />

C 171 140 76 20 3 0 0 0 1 20 64 163<br />

A: Maximum average temperature (°C)<br />

B: Minimum average temperature (°C)<br />

C: Average rainfall (mm)<br />

Day 1: Fly to Zimbabwe via Johannesburg<br />

Fly overnight from London (regional<br />

connections available) to Victoria Falls,<br />

Zimbabwe via Johannesburg. (N)<br />

Day 2: Victoria Falls<br />

Arrive and proceed to your hotel for a freshen<br />

up, before your special welcome by a guest<br />

speaker ahead of your dinner. Overnight at the<br />

Rock paintings, Matobo National Park<br />

Pioneers Lodge (or similar). (D)<br />

Day 3: Victoria Falls<br />

This morning, visit a village approximately<br />

20km from Victoria Falls town where you can<br />

witness daily life unfold. This is a chance for<br />

a rewarding cultural exchange as well as an<br />

insight into rural Zimbabwean living. Dine at<br />

a traditional local restaurant before returning<br />

to your hotel. Later, a sundowner cruise on<br />

the Zambezi provides the cherry on top.<br />

Overnight at the Pioneers Lodge (or similar).<br />

(B, L)<br />

Day 4: Victoria Falls<br />

Embark on a private guided tour of Victoria<br />

Falls – whose local name aptly translates to<br />

'The Smoke that Thunders'. Whilst regaling you<br />

with interesting facts and figures, your guide<br />

will ensure you have plenty of opportunities to<br />

photograph this iconic UNESCO World Heritage<br />

Site. Continue to the Elephant’s Walk shopping<br />

centre and art village for a special behindthe-scenes<br />

visit of the Ndau Studio, meeting<br />

its local artists and craftsmen. Later this<br />

afternoon, stop by the famous Victoria Falls<br />

Hotel for afternoon tea on the Stanley Terrace<br />

with a view of the Victoria Falls Bridge.<br />

Nibble on savouries and cakes with your<br />

favourite tea. Return to the hotel with your<br />

evening at leisure. Overnight at the Pioneers<br />

Lodge (or similar). (B)<br />

Day 5: Hwange National Park<br />

A four-hour drive delivers you deep inside a<br />

private concession in Hwange National Park’s<br />

northern reaches. This region is renowned<br />

for wildlife viewing opportunities, as you<br />

will discover with days of thrilling safaris ahead<br />

of you. Overnight at Nehimba Lodge<br />
